The national LP counts its Michigan members as of December 31 of this year and awards delegates to next May's Libertarian Party Presidential Nominating Convention, based on how many national sustaining members reside in Michigan. The more national members we have, the more delegates we receive. If our membership falls in the top 10 states (we are currently hanging on to 10th place), then we also get to appoint a delegate to the national Platform Committee.
